A moody, atmospheric study of the Maine coast by American painter Charles Herbert Woodbury, featuring deep water reflections and rugged shoreline textures.
Charles Herbert Woodbury, a painter known for his technical mastery of water, captures a quiet moment at Gerrish Island in this work. The composition focuses on the interplay between the dark, reflective surface of the water and the rugged, shadowed shoreline. Woodbury employs a palette dominated by deep greens, earthy browns, and ochres, which effectively convey the weight and density of the coastal environment.
The artist uses broad, confident brushstrokes to define the movement of the water. Rather than attempting a literal transcription of the scene, he prioritises the physical sensation of the tide and the light. A small, singular point of red draws the eye toward the centre of the water, providing a sharp contrast to the surrounding gloom. This detail suggests a swimmer or a buoy, adding a human element to the otherwise solitary coastal setting.
Woodbury spent much of his career in Maine, where he developed a deep understanding of the Atlantic coast. His approach to painting water often involved observing the ocean from various vantage points, including from above, which allowed him to study the patterns of waves and reflections with scientific precision. This piece reflects his ability to balance observation with a painterly application of pigment. The shadows cast by the rocks are rendered with thick, opaque layers, while the water surface features thinner, more fluid applications of paint. The result is a work that feels both immediate and considered, capturing the specific atmosphere of a New England shoreline without unnecessary detail.
